#9e6208 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#9e6208 is composed of 62% red, 38.4%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38% magenta, 94.9%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 36 degrees, a saturation of 90.4% and a lightness of 32.5%. #9e6208 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c410 with #3d0000. Closest websafe color is: #996600.

#9e6208 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#9e6208 has RGB values of R:158, G:98,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.95,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 10379784.

Shades and Tints of #9e6208
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090500 is the darkest color, while #fefbf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#9e6208
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#58544e is the less saturated color, while #a46302 is the most saturated one.
